Technical field
The present invention relates to satellite development process and in-orbit telemetering programming technique fields, and in particular to a kind of star it is integrated Telemetering configuring management method.
Background technique
As shown in Fig. 7, for satellite telemetry there are a variety of telemetry modes, every kind of telemetry mode has corresponding frame table to configure, In satellite development process, telemetry frame table layout scheme repeatedly changes, and consumes the great effort of observing and controlling Yu Star Service subsystem.It surveys Control is with Star Service subsystem personnel first and under information in the quantity, size, packet of each satellite subsystem communication and coordination telemetering packet The frequency is passed, telemetering packet is distributed according to the required frequency to the respective section of telemetry frame, if telemetering inadequate resource, considers adjustment Telemetry frame subregion division mode, or coordinate with each subsystem, the requirement of the biography frequency down of telemetering cell is reduced, by repeatedly round-trip Coordinate, determine each telemetering pack arrangement and pass frequency demand down, on this basis layout Star Service frame table and telemetering framing filing text Part.
After satellite telemetry scheme determines, telemetering archive file is delivered comprehensive survey personnel by tracking-telemetry and command subsystem, and comprehensive survey personnel start It configures telemetering and parses big table, the telemetering amount of the whole each subsystem of star is huge, and in satellite development stage, telemetering framing and processing Method repeatedly converts, and input file has the problems such as writing mistake, seriously consumes the energy of comprehensive survey.It is set to observing and controlling and Star Service After counting Star Service frame table, comprehensive survey is just initially configured ground telemetering and parses big table, fails to star collaborative design, the comprehensive examining system in ground It is difficult to telemetering on fast adaptation star to modify, increases the urgency of comprehensive survey personnel telemetering configuration work.After satellite is in-orbit, certain feelings Take remote measurement On-board programming under condition, rearrange Star Service telemetering programming note number and configuration ground telemetering parse big table be both needed to expend it is big Measure energy, it is difficult to the On-board programming of telemetering and the fast adaptation of ground long tube system telemetry parsing be rapidly completed, delay satellite Problem investigation.
Through the literature search of existing technologies, Chinese invention patent 201410163232.9 is disclosed using modularization Configurable telemetry parameter dissection process system, is designed using modular architecture, by telemetry parameter dissection process process point Be cut into multiple modules, each module keeps certain functional independence, can it is individually designed, upgrading or replacement, use simultaneously The mode of basic database realizes the flexible configuration of Various types of data processing method, can quickly support the synchronism detection of more spacecrafts, Can be good at adapting to the variation that Large-scale satellite integrated test system is tested telemetry parameter demand, versatility and flexibility compared with It is good.But the prior art does not solve the tool of with how realizing satellite telemetry configuration star integrated management proposed by the invention Body problem.

1, the star of PCM telemetering system ground frame table automatic generation method (such as Fig. 2);
Template definition: telemetry frame includes frame head area, postamble area, frame data domain area, as defined in the table below under certain telemetry mode Frame data domain is divided into 1 frame/period, 4 frames/period, 16 frames/period, 32 frames/period etc. (with 2 by frame data domain multiplex moden Frame/period is divided).Framing basic unit generate: according to subsystem provide offer telemetering packet cells structure table, Processing generates basic Framing unit (abbreviation frame member).
Certain telemetry mode frame structure template of 1 PCM telemetering of table
2 telemetering packet cells structure table of table
According to whole byte constraint condition, telemetering packet is divided into several segments, each segment is integer byte, if comprising Dry telemetering cell.Property at same frame according to telemetering cell constrains (the biography time consistencies down of i.e. multiple cells), will have property at same frame to want The multiple segments asked are bundled into a combination segment, combine each sub-piece in segment have it is identical under pass the frequency.By adjacent The constraints such as the property at same frame between the whole byte and cell of consecutive cell combination, telemetering packet is divided into and isolates segment one by one, these Isolated segment is the minimum thread of framing, abbreviation frame member.
For multiplexing telemetering packet, (i.e. a telemetering packet has a variety of cells forms, a variety of cells mode timesharing Be multiplexed the same telemetering packet resource), the frame member of telemetering packet should multiplex mode used in telemetering packet marks off thus each frame member most Big union.
Frame member has different biography frequency demands down under different telemetry modes, and different telemetry modes have not With telemetering Partition Mask.Partition Mask bearing capacity evaluation: being directed to certain telemetry mode M, is divided according to observing and controlling and the telemetering of Star Service, Determine each partition size (can adjust according to the actual situation).
It is divided according to template, is divided into 4 frame areas, 16 frame areas, 64 frame areas.By taking 4 frame areas as an example, this section is W30~W70 (41 Byte), then total bearing capacity is 4*41=164 byte.According to the telemetering packet source data that each subsystem provides, delta frame Member counts wherein 4 frames/period frame member summation, assesses the bearing capacity of current subregion.If cannot carry, adjustment source is considered The frequency demand or adjustment partition size of data, guarantee each subregion adaptation.It can also be assessed according to each input information requirement The size requirement situation in 1 frame area, 4 frame areas, 16 frame areas, 64 frame areas instructs subregion with this, or feeds back to each family, adjustment input The frequency demand of information is to adapt to radio frequency channel resource.
Radio frequency channel automatic editing in subregion: by taking 4 frame areas as an example, this area's schematic diagram as shown in figure 8,4 frames one recycle, be divided into one, Two, three, four totally four time division multiplexing areas.It is assessed by early period, bearing capacity is with meet demand.The frame member that telemetering packet is generated according to It is secondary to be put into lower template.
Constraint condition: it is necessary in the frontier district (being herein one, the W70 of two, three, four each subdivisions) of each subdivision The ending for completing frame member does not allow frame member to be divided, i.e. frame member is not divided in time-domain, and blank parts temporarily fill AA. Recommend with frequency multiplexing area to be continuous section, but actual conditions may change, such as: it is distributed in and several does not connect there are 4 frame areas On continuous section, sample situation is as shown in Fig. 9 Partition Mask.Constraint condition at this time is still: the ending of each sub-segments is One in a frame telemetering of the ending (it is the ending of whole frame member that situation, which is W70, W211, in figure) of one frame member, i.e. frame member Do not allow to be divided in sub-segments.
Ground telemetering parsing frame table automatically generates: ground describes telemetering packet in (r, c) (Bale No., packet in byte location) mode Middle information position, therefore each frame member has oneself corresponding (r, c) coordinate section.As shown in Figure 10.
Frame member is completed by above step to distribute into telemetering Partition Mask, its (r, c) coordinate section of frame member is retouched It states, can be obtained ground telemetering frame parsing frame table, see the table below.
Star Service frame table automatically generates: according to telemetering packet (r, c) coordinate and Star Service storage management address (such as address ram) one One corresponding relationship can obtain Star Service frame table, see the table below.
After obtaining Star Service frame table, Star Service frame table is converted into hex configuration file, programming enters Star Service frame table configuration ROM.Simultaneously According to having reverse ability, ground telemetering can be inversely gone out from Star Service frame table configuration file and parse frame table, with completing star telemetry frame table Bumpless transfer.
In-orbit telemetering programming note number automatically generates: can export the programming telemetering area radio frequency channel table in Star Service frame table, be packaged into It programs telemetering and infuses number packet format, upper note satellite modifies the frame table configuration of Star Service, completes in-orbit telemetry frame table change, while ground The long tube hub of observing and controlling can also the modification of fast adaptation Star Service frame table.
Telemetering archive file automatically generates: exporting the telemetering framing file and telemetering cell parameters processing method text of filing Part reduces the workload of file edit, reduces file edit error probability.

3, the telemetry frame stratification process of analysis (such as Fig. 3) of PCM telemetering system;
Ground receiver telemetry carries out stratification parsing.The ground parsing frame table for reading corresponding telemetry mode, by telemetering Frame resolves into discrete segments, and segment is distributed to corresponding telemetering packet.For PCM telemetering, by the byte in telemetry frame according to frame table (r, c) index, distribution is extremely wrapped at c-th of byte of r, and shows that this byte has refreshed in packet.
Each telemetering packet is traversed, if information is refreshed in packet, to more new information according to telemetering packet cells structure table, Telemetering cell one by one is resolved into, by telemetering cell true form information update to the corresponding telemetering amount of cell layer.If telemetering packet exists multiple With, then according to multiplexed situation, select corresponding telemetering packet cells structure table, take remote measurement packet to telemetering cell decomposition.
It to the telemetering cell of update, is calculated according to the processing method of configuration, obtains the physical quantity of telemetering cell, according to The criterion of configuration judges whether physical quantity is abnormal.The telemetering cell physics parsed is shown, real-time telemetry is distinguished and prolongs When telemetering amount, and show physical quantity judging result.
4, the telemetry frame stratification process of analysis (such as Fig. 4) of packet telemetry system;
Two ways can be used in the decomposition of packet telemetry frame to telemetering packet: it is a kind of using precognition frame table, read corresponding telemetering The ground of mode parses frame table, according to the index frame table of (Bale No.+packet is long), if telemetry frame is resolved into a packet, refreshes corresponding distant Survey package informatin;A kind of mode based on first top guide pointer+pack arrangement parses, and according to first top guide pointer, finds first packet, then according to first Packet length, finds next telemetering packet, long according to this telemetering packet, finds next telemetering packet, so completes telemetry frame to distant The decomposition for surveying packet, refreshes corresponding telemetering package informatin.
Each telemetering packet is traversed, if information is refreshed in packet, to more new information according to telemetering packet cells structure table, Telemetering cell one by one is resolved into, by telemetering cell true form information update to the corresponding telemetering amount of cell layer.If telemetering packet exists multiple With, then according to multiplexed situation, select corresponding telemetering packet cells structure table, take remote measurement packet to telemetering cell decomposition.
It to the telemetering cell of update, is calculated according to the processing method of configuration, obtains the physical quantity of telemetering cell, according to The criterion of configuration judges whether physical quantity is abnormal.The telemetering cell physics parsed is shown, real-time telemetry is distinguished and prolongs When telemetering amount, and show physical quantity judging result.
5, telemetering stratification is equivalent and compares process;
In ground observing and controlling and the test of Star Service semi physical, identical telemetering cell amount, ground foundation can by star be shared The big table of stratification, by telemetering cell generate telemetering packet, by telemetering packet generate telemetry frame, then compare ground generate telemetry frame with The telemetering that star passes up and down, closed loop are completed satellite telemetry and are collected and framing functional verification.
In the test of Star Service semi physical, identical telemetering amount is shared to star.Satellite is motivated with the telemetering amount that test equipment is simulated Each slave computer generates telemetering packet, or generates telemetering packet, each slave computer or slave computer interface mould using slave computer interface simulator Telemetering packet is sent to Star Service and carries out framing by quasi- device.
The telemetering amount of simulation is sent to the cell layer of the big table of stratification by Star Service semi physical test equipment, updates cell layer Telemetering cell amount.According to the cells structure table of telemetering packet, telemetering packet is generated with the telemetering amount tissue of cell layer.
According to the scheduling of telemetering group frame pattern and multiplexing time controller, respective frame table and corresponding counts beat are selected, is mentioned Information in telemetering packet is taken to generate telemetry frame;After the equivalent generation of stratification for completing telemetry frame, telemetry frame is sent to telemetering closed loop Comparison module.Telemetering closed loop comparison module receives Star Service telemetry frame, and the telemetry frame generated with comparing star completes the closed loop of telemetry frame It compares.
The telemetry frame passed down to satellite simultaneously carries out stratification parsing, compare the telemetering cell physical quantity that parses whether with The telemetering amount of test equipment simulation is consistent, verifies the correctness of Star Service framing.
